Rate Index gauges truck lane profitability

Feb 1, 2009 12:00 PM

Getloaded.com has launched its Rate Index feature, allowing transportation companies and truckers to measure the profitability of truck lanes. Rate Index will track critical data of more than 12 million truckload lanes for 1,200 major North American market areas.

Rate Index breaks down the most profitable truckload lanes by analyzing the average rate per mile, minimum rate per mile, maximum rate per mile, average fuel surcharge per mile, and average accessorial charges. The feature helps transportation professionals target where they want to haul freight based on the money generated by certain routes, allowing them to negotiate better rates to maximize profits.
